Sri Lanka is set to name a new ODI captain next week, replacing current skipper Thisara Perera with either Angelo Mathews or Dinesh Chandimal, Sri Lanka Cricket (SLC) said. Both Mathews and Chandimal have led the ODI side in the past, while Perera had captained Sri Lanka in the recent ODIs against India.


"The Chairman of selectors has informed me that they are considering appointing either Angelo Mathews or Dinesh Chandimal to fill the role," SLC president Thilanga Sumathipala said. The SLC sources said the head coach Chandika Hathurusinghe is focused on the 2019 World Cup and wants a permanent solution to the captaincy problem.
